...If you see pistils, then it is budding... buds are just a bunch of female flowers- which consist of a calyx and two pistils- basically growing on top of eachother. you're only three days into flowering... There is PLENTY more flowering to be done. The plant will keep producing flowers right up until harvest, so no worries.
